数据库原理与设计Oracle版课程设计
课程目标和重点
课程目标
本课程旨在培养学生对于关系型数据库的理解和应用能力,能够熟练地使用Oracle数据库管理系统进行数据建模、数据查询、数据维护和数据安全管理等方面的操作。
课程重点
本课程将着重教授以下内容:
1.Oracle数据库体系结构与安装
2.数据库设计原则和范式
3.SQL语言基础和进阶查询
4.PL/SQL编程语言基础
5.数据库备份和恢复
6.数据库性能优化
课程安排
第一周:Oracle数据库体系结构与安装
课堂讲解:Oracle数据库的架构和基本概念。
实验操作:使用Oracle Universal Installer进行数据库安装和配置。
第二周:数据库设计原则和范式
课堂讲解:关系型数据库的设计原则和范式理论。
实验操作:使用SQL Developer进行逻辑设计和物理设计。
第三周:SQL语言基础和进阶查询
课堂讲解:SQL语言的基础语法和常用查询语句。
实验操作:使用SQL Developer进行数据查询和数据统计。
第四周:PL/SQL编程语言基础
课堂讲解:PL/SQL语言的基础语法和变量、常量、游标的概念。
实验操作:使用SQL Developer进行PL/SQL编程实践。
第五周:数据库备份和恢复
课堂讲解:数据库备份和恢复的概念和方法。
实验操作:使用SQL Developer管理数据库备份和恢复操作。
第六周:数据库性能优化
oracle游标的使用•课堂讲解:数据库性能的影响因素和优化策略。
实验操作:使用SQL Developer进行数据库性能优化实验。
实验教材与参考资料
《Oracle 11g数据库管理与开发教程》
《SQL语言基础与提高》
《Oracle数据库原理与应用》
课程考核方式
7.实验报告:占总成绩的50%。
8.期末考核:占总成绩的50%。
总结
通过本课程的学习,学生将对于Oracle数据库的应用和管理有更加直观和深入的认识和理解,同时也能够为后续的数据库开发和应用打下更加扎实的基础。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。